If you have a salon nearby that carries the designer, they should be able to bring in dresses from that line for you. This will probably cost you a fee per dress, but will probably be worth that much travel.

Also, just because a store carries a line, it does not mean they will have every dress in that line. Most smaller shops only carry a few dresses by each designer. They also will not bring in an entire collection just because they are having a trunk show. You can call the store and request a style, but it doesn''t mean they will be able to bring a sample.

My advice is to not travel around the country looking for dresses. Open up your search. Hit up some local shops and try on everything. If you are still unable to find a dress you like, bring in a couple samples you like in styles that look best on you. Having also taken a dress internationally for a DW, I would also suggest heavy fabrics, even though you might currently think they are over the top). You simply cannot guarantee your dress won''t be shoved into an overhead bin (even if you call ahead of time and arrange for closet space--trust me) unless you are flying first class. Even if you are flying first class, with layovers, customs, and security lines, there is no way to keep the dress perfect. Heavier fabrics will hold their shape much better and will likely not have to be steamed or pressed upon arrival.
